Work on to make Sanya a city focused on sports

- By LI YINGXUE liyingxue@chinadaily.com.cn

The Chinese women’s 9-ball world champion Pan Xiaoting walks onto the red carpet, together with 63 other female billiards players, each wearing a lei — it’s like a runway show.

Along the carpet, there are totem poles, palms, coconut trees, and tourists — they are in Sanya Romance Park, a popular scenic spot which is a cultural microcosm of Hainan province.

It’s the opening ceremony of the 2018 Hainan Sanya Women’s World 9-Ball Championsh­ip, from Dec 3 to 9, with a total prize of $175,000.

The event, hosted by China’s Billiards & Snooker Associatio­n and Department of Sports, Culture, Radio, Television and Publicatio­n of Sanya, is the city’s first top level internatio­nal billiards competitio­n.

For the opening ceremony, the organizers decided to hold the event at Sanya Romance Park, which is covered in primeval forest and has different theme areas.

“We want to open the tunnel between sports and tourism in Sanya, and this ceremony is our first effort,” says Chen Zhenmin, the director of the Department of Sports, Culture, Radio, Television and Publicatio­n of Sanya.

At the venue, players were exposed to China’s intangible cultural heritage such as weaving Li brocade and blowing sugar-figures.

The Romantic Show of Sanya, which is staged at the park each day, lets visitors enjoy multiple art forms’ show and learn about the history of Sanya.

Speaking about the arrangemen­ts, Pan says: “When we are in competitio­n, we are always nervous, but in Sanya the comfortabl­e environmen­t and the scenery has helped me relax.”

Sanya, which is located on the “edge of heaven and in a corner of the sea” in Hainan province is one of most popular tourism cities in China.

But now, it’s not only a beautiful and romantic tourism city, but also a sports venue.

According to Li Wujun, vice secretary-general of the Sanya municipal government, Sanya’s current gross domestic product has jumped 353fold over 30 years, achieving historic leaps forward in the economic and social fields.

“Since the setting up of the city, Sanya has gone from being a small fishing village girl to becoming an internatio­nally well-known modern lady,” says Li.

Since April, Sanya has taken President Xi Jinping’s speech on the 30th anniversar­y of the Hainan special economic zone to heart, by taking concrete actions to build the Hainan pilot free trade zone, a free trade port with Chinese characteri­stics.

“Sports tourism is one of the new ways for Sanya to actively explore tourism, which earlier used to rely only on its unique natural and tourism resources,” says Li.

In recent years, a number of internatio­nal sports events have chosen Sanya, including the Central Hainan Internatio­nal Road Cycling Race, the Youth Sailing World Championsh­ips, and the Volvo Ocean Race.

In July, the Sanya Serenity Coast clinched the overall Clipper Round of the World Yacht Race, the first time a Chinese boat has won this competitio­n. And one month later, Sanya earned the bid to host the sixth Asian Beach Games in 2020.

Li says the events had not only caused a rise in public fitness in Sanya, but also greatly boosted the developmen­t of the tourism sector, creating a deep convergenc­e between sports events and Sanya’s tourism.

Separately, the Sanya Ball King series competitio­n has been held for three consecutiv­e years. And this year’s competitio­n involves nine sports including soccer, basketball, volleyball, table tennis, badminton and tennis.

According to Chen, this year’s competitio­n attracted amateur athletes aged from 7 to 82.

“It (the series) has become a calling card for Sanya, and it’s not only for Sanya’s residents. We are inviting ball game lovers from around the world to join us as the Sanya Ball King can be the World Ball King,” Chen says.

In another developmen­t, Sanya and the Guoao group signed an agreement on June 1 under which the two sides will cooperate in the fields of sports, culture, tourism, and rural revitaliza­tion. And the 2018 Hainan Sanya Women’s World 9-ball Championsh­ip is the first sports project being held under the agreement.

Also, Sanya and the Guoao group plan to build more sports facilities in the parks and on the beach, says Chen.

As Sanya is a coastal city, beach sports and water sports will be the main sports there, says Chen, adding that a sailing school from Qingdao, in Shandong province, and a diving school from Zhanjiang, in Guangdong province, will also set up branches in Sanya.

“Each city has unique characteri­stics, and our goal is to make Sanya a sports hub in the winter,” says Chen.
